The pass will also give you reduced-price bus travel after 6.00 pm on college days, all day at weekends and during college holidays on services operated by the bus companies listed below. The legal responsibility for ensuring that a child attends school rests with the parents. Your child will be entitled to free school transport to the nearest school to your home address, or the school designated to serve your home address, as long as it is more than three miles away from your home by the shortest walking route.
